php - 卡纳达语单词在 Firefox 浏览器中显示为问号

标签 php html mysql firefox

我正在尝试在 Ubuntu 12.04 上的 mozilla 浏览器中通过 MySql 连接显示卡纳达语单词。

我使用了排序规则 utf-8 通用 ci 并在 php 中使用了 header('Content-type:text/html; charset=utf-32'); php 代码。

当我尝试从数据库中检索单词并将其显示在 Firefox 浏览器上时,它显示为问号...

请帮忙。

最佳答案

您在 header 中声明的字符编码必须与实际编码相同。看起来它们根本不同(UTF-32 与可能的 UTF-8)。找出实际的编码并声明它。

不要在网页上使用 UTF-32。 Firefox 是最后一个支持它的主要浏览器,support was removed 2011 年。

关于php - 卡纳达语单词在 Firefox 浏览器中显示为问号,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22111542/

相关文章:

PHP加密&VB.net解密

php - 将单个行数据从 mysql 通过电子邮件发送给单个用户

php - PHP中的公共(public)静态函数和静态公共(public)函数有什么区别?

php - 不显示特殊西类牙字符,Codeigniter MySQL

mysql - 通过数据库级​​别本身的查询反序列化

php - Laravel 如何为 where like 查询动态数组列名称?

javascript - 验证具有相同名称 [ ] 和不同行类别的输入

JavaFX Applet 网页刷新和关闭通知

jquery - 带有可能换行的文本的点领导者

php - 为什么准备好的语句似乎没有(再次)绑定(bind)结果?